    3. Recieved this yesterday from a wonderful lady in Crawford, I am posting this here as it pertains to some Ex Randolph families. Sorry I didnt get the name of news paper concerned yet,I would think it was the 1910 local Girard one. WRIGHT- In Crawford township, Feb 8th, 1910, of heart trouble. Alfred G Wright, aged 41 years and 11 months. Death was very sudden. He had been working for Wm.HOLLAND, on the old fair grounds, this winter, and Tuesday was not feeling well and walked to Girard in the afternoon to get some medicine, returning home and helping to do the feeding in the evening, later eating supper. He went to bed about 9 o'clock, and about fifteen minutes later got up, saying he could not get his breath. He died in Mr Hollands arms within a few minutes. Mr Wright was reared by Mr and Mrs John ANDREW, his mother dying when he was two years old. He accompanied the Andrew family to this county in 1886, and has been with them most of the time since. He was a bachelor. The funeral will take place at 2 o'clock this afternoon from the home of John Andrew, one mile west of the cemetery, Rev. A.H.Morrison officiating. He was a member of Girard Lodge No 55, I.O.O.F. Sadly, Alfred never married so theres no family to trace for him but at least he has been 'found'.
